Job Summary:



This is a dynamic opportunity for a driven and proactive professional who thrives in fast-paced environments. As Executive Assistant to our CEO, you'll manage daily operations, provide high-level administrative support, and serve as a trusted partner in ensuring the business runs smoothly behind the scenes. Your ability to multitask, stay calm under pressure, and maintain impeccable attention to detail will be key to success in this role.

Key Responsibilities:



Manage the CEO's complex and shifting calendar, scheduling meetings, calls, and travel with accuracy and discretion Coordinate logistics for client meetings, internal team sessions, and event planning milestones Arrange staffing of entertainers, production and logistics for each of the CEO's events while considering budgets. Includes booking event production and coordinating logistics pre and post events. Compiling & preparing pre-event run down sent to on-site staff Draft and edit emails, communications, proposals, and event-related documents Organize and maintain files, event budgets, records, contracts, and timelines with a focus on accuracy and efficiency Anticipate the CEO's needs and proactively address potential scheduling or operational conflicts Book and manage detailed travel arrangements including accommodations, flights, and transportation Handle confidential information with the utmost integrity Support special projects and provide research, reporting, and coordination support as needed

Qualifications:



2+ years of experience as an Executive Assistant, ideally supporting a CEO or C-suite executive Previous experience in the events, hospitality, or creative industries is highly preferred Outstanding organizational and time management skills Strong verbal and written communication skills Ability to work under pressure, problem solve, and manage competing priorities with grace Strong initiative and ability to work independently Proficiency in Microsoft Office, Google Workspace, Monday.com, Canva and scheduling or project management tools.
